Description

2-Chloro-3-Hydroxy-4-Picoline is a versatile halogenated pyridine derivative that serves as a critical building block in advanced organic synthesis. This compound is valued for its unique substitution pattern, which allows for selective functionalization and incorporation into complex molecular architectures. It is primarily sought after by research chemists and process development scientists in the pharmaceutical and agrochemical industries for the development of new active ingredients and fine chemicals.

Application

  • Pharmaceutical Intermediate: A key precursor in the synthesis of novel drug candidates, particularly those targeting central nervous system (CNS) disorders and infectious diseases.
  • Agrochemical Synthesis: Used in the research and development of new herbicides, fungicides, and insecticides, leveraging its heterocyclic core for bioactivity.
  • Ligand and Catalyst Development: Employed in the preparation of specialized ligands for metal catalysis and organocatalysts due to the chelating potential of the pyridine nitrogen and hydroxyl group.
  • Material Science Research: Acts as a monomer or functionalizing agent in the creation of advanced polymers and organic electronic materials.
  • Chemical Reference Standard: Serves as a high-purity analytical standard for quality control and method development in analytical laboratories.

Basic Information

Product Name 2-Chloro-3-Hydroxy-4-Picoline
CAS No. 884494-70-6
Molecular Formula C6H6ClNO
Molecular Weight 143.57 g/mol
Synonyms 3-Hydroxy-2-chloro-4-methylpyridine; 2-Chloro-3-hydroxy-4-methylpyridine; 4-Methyl-2-chloro-3-pyridinol; 3-Pyridinol, 2-chloro-4-methyl-; 2-Chloro-4-methylpyridin-3-ol; 4-Picoline, 2-chloro-3-hydroxy-

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at a controlled room temperature (15-25°C). Keep away from strong oxidizing agents and strong bases. For long-term storage, consider an inert atmosphere to maintain optimal stability.
